Separated from the mountain range by two deep gorges, Masada was a natural fortress. In 66 CE, during the Jewish Revolt against the Romans, Masada was captured by a small group of Jews. In 72 CE, however, the Roman General Silva decided to put an end to even the tiniest pockets of resistance against Rome. With an army ten to fifteen thousand, he began the siege of Masada. When the Zealot leader Eleazar ben Jair saw the end nearing, he gathered his people and together they chose death with honor by their own hands rather than being captured alive and becoming slaves to the Romans.
